Control Cabinet Protection Strategy
In heavy-duty DC drive control cabinets, the SDCS-CON-4 does not operate in isolation — it functions as the command core within a layered protection architecture. Reliable operation depends on the integrity of every component in the control chain. The SDCS-POW-1 power supply board provides regulated 24 VDC logic power to the control module; any instability in this supply directly impacts the SDCS-CON-4’s ability to maintain stable speed and torque references. Pairing the SDCS-CON-4 with a verified SDCS-POW-1 eliminates a common root cause of intermittent drive faults in aging DCS800 installations.
For field excitation control, the SDCS-FEX-2 field excitation module works in close coordination with the SDCS-CON-4 to regulate motor field current. Loss of field excitation is one of the most dangerous failure modes in DC drive systems, potentially causing motor runaway. The SDCS-CON-4’s field loss detection logic interfaces directly with the SDCS-FEX-2 to trigger protective shutdown sequences before mechanical damage occurs.
In environments with high electromagnetic interference — common in steel mills, mining hoists, and port crane drives — the SDCS-COM-8 fieldbus communication adapter ensures that control signals between the DCS800 and the plant-level SCADA or DCS remain stable and error-free. Signal corruption at the communication layer can cause the SDCS-CON-4 to receive erroneous speed references, leading to process upsets. A properly specified SDCS-COM-8 or SDCS-COM-81 adapter, matched to the site’s fieldbus protocol (PROFIBUS, DeviceNet, or Modbus), is a critical element of the overall drive protection strategy.
For installations where the DCS800 drive operates in parallel with other ABB drives or motor control centers, the SDCS-IOE-1 I/O extension module expands the digital and analog I/O capacity of the control system, enabling more granular interlocking and safety relay integration. This is particularly valuable in continuous casting lines, paper machine drives, and chemical reactor agitator systems where multi-axis coordination is required. Additionally, surge protection devices installed at the cabinet’s incoming power terminals — such as ABB’s OVR series surge arresters — provide the first line of defense against transient overvoltages that could otherwise damage the SDCS-CON-4’s sensitive control circuitry.
Critical Industrial Safety Applications
The ABB SDCS-CON-4 3ADT313900R1001 is deployed across the most demanding industrial sectors where DC drive reliability is non-negotiable:
Petrochemical & Refinery Operations: In crude oil pump drives, compressor trains, and reactor agitator systems, the SDCS-CON-4 maintains precise speed control under variable load conditions. Its fault-tolerant architecture ensures that process upsets — such as sudden load changes or feedstock viscosity variations — do not translate into uncontrolled drive trips that could compromise process safety systems.
Electric Power Generation & Utilities: Coal pulverizer drives, induced draft fan drives, and boiler feed pump drives in thermal power plants rely on DCS800 systems with SDCS-CON-4 control modules for continuous, uninterrupted operation. In these applications, a drive fault during peak generation periods can result in load shedding events with grid-level consequences.
Mining & Mineral Processing: Hoist drives, conveyor drives, and ball mill drives in underground and open-pit mining operations subject control electronics to extreme vibration, dust ingress, and wide temperature swings. The SDCS-CON-4’s robust design and conformal-coated PCB construction provide reliable operation in these harsh conditions, reducing the frequency of unplanned maintenance interventions.
Water & Wastewater Treatment: Municipal water treatment plants and industrial effluent systems use DC drives for pump speed control and aeration blower regulation. The SDCS-CON-4’s precise torque control capability enables energy-efficient operation while its fault detection logic prevents pump cavitation damage caused by speed reference errors.
Metallurgy & Steel Production: Rolling mill main drives, coiler drives, and ladle crane drives in steel plants represent some of the most demanding DC drive applications. The SDCS-CON-4’s high-bandwidth current control loop and fast fault response are essential for maintaining strip tension control and preventing cobble events in hot and cold rolling operations.
Port & Marine Applications: Container crane drives, ship-to-shore crane hoists, and vessel propulsion systems in marine environments require drive control modules that can withstand salt-laden air, humidity, and continuous duty cycles. The SDCS-CON-4’s environmental tolerance and proven reliability in these applications make it a preferred replacement module for port operators managing aging crane fleets.
